Anno 1800 Production Chain Renderer
A production chain diagram for Anno 1800. Based on the original diagram by /u/toby_p from Reddit.
This uses Vue3 (Quasar) and MermaidJS to render the diagrams.

Contributions
To make changes to the diagram follow the instructions below. You will need yarn installed locally.
Install dependencies
Clone the repository and install dependencies.
git clone https://github.com/dtomlinson91/anno-production-chain-renderer.git
yarn
Install Quasar CLI
yarn global add @quasar/cli
Start the app in development mode (hot-code reloading, error reporting, etc.)
quasar dev
Open http://localhost:9000/anno-production-chain-renderer/#/ in your browser.
Edit existing chain
To make changes to an existing chain edit the ratio/efficiency in either:
src/pages/data/production-chains-base.tsfor chains up to S4.src/pages/data/production-chains-expansions.tsfor chains after S4.
Examples below use Bricks:
{
productionChain: 'bricks',
chainMultiplier: '2',
mermaidDefinition: endent`
flowchart LR
Clay(<span class='icon-flex-row'><img src='${icons.clayI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='icon-flex-col q-pl-sm'><span class='efficiency-perc'>50%</span><span class='ratio-count'>1</span></span></span>)
Bricks(<img src='${icons.bricksI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='ratio-count'>1</span>)
Clay --> Bricks
`
}
Edit number of buildings
For example to change the number of brick factories from 1 to 2:
Change
Bricks(<img src='${icons.bricksI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='ratio-count'>1</span>)
to
Bricks(<img src='${icons.bricksI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='ratio-count'>2</span>)
Edit efficiency
For example to change the efficiency of the clay mines from 50% to 75%:
Change
Clay(<span class='icon-flex-row'><img src='${icons.clayI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='icon-flex-col q-pl-sm'><span class='efficiency-perc'>50%</span><span class='ratio-count'>1</span></span></span>)
to
Clay(<span class='icon-flex-row'><img src='${icons.clayI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='icon-flex-col q-pl-sm'><span class='efficiency-perc'>75%</span><span class='ratio-count'>1</span></span></span>)
Add/Remove electricity
For example to add electricity to brick factory:
Add:
style Bricks stroke:#0675BD,stroke-width:5px,stroke-dasharray: 7 7
before the Mermaid graph definition:
Bricks(<img src='${icons.bricksI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='ratio-count'>1</span>)
style Bricks stroke:#0675BD,stroke-width:5px,stroke-dasharray: 7 7
Clay --> Bricks

Mermaid definitions
See the documentation for mermaid flowcharts here.
A mermaid definition starts with
flowchart LR
You can use TB instead of LB if the diagram should be rendered top to bottom.
Standard building
To define a standard building (no efficiency modifier):
Name(<img src='${icons.nameI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='ratio-count'>1</span>)
Change:
Name- Give the building a name in the chain.{icons.nameIcon}- Change the icon to match the icon insrc/pages/data/icons.ts.- Change the ratio count in
<span class='ratio-count'>1</span>.
Reduced efficiency building
To define a building with reduced efficiency:
Name(<span class='icon-flex-row'><img src='${icons.nameIcon}' class='icon-size' /><span class='icon-flex-col q-pl-sm'><span class='efficiency-perc'>50%</span><span class='ratio-count'>1</span></span></span>)
In addition to the changes above:
- Change the efficiency percentage in
<span class='efficiency-perc'>50%</span>.
Electricity building
To make a building electrified follow the instructions above under the header "Add/Remove electricity".
Define graph
To define the graph use the Name which you defined for each building:
Charcoal & Iron --> Steel --> SewingMachines
Wood --> SewingMachines
